The Independent Contractor Agreement for delivery drivers with their own car in Contra Costa establishes the terms between a Contractor and a Carrier. It outlines the responsibilities of the Contractor, who must provide transportation services for shipments, while maintaining necessary insurance coverage. The Carrier agrees to handle invoicing and freight charge collections, ensuring timely payments to the Contractor upon receipt of required documentation. Key features include liability and cargo insurance provisions, communication requirements in case of delays, and stipulations about compensation frameworks based on several factors. The Agreement emphasizes the independent relationship between the Contractor and Carrier, protecting both parties' rights and outlining consequences for solicitation of business outside of agreed channels.
